fre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內容

單線溫度傳感器外文翻譯-其他專業(yè)-資料下載頁

2025-01-19 08:06本頁面

【導讀】●Availablein8-pinSO(150mil),8-pinSOP,and3-pinTO-92packages. powereddown.

  

【正文】 溫度傳感器的分辨率為用戶配置至 9, 10, 11或 12位,相當于 176。 C , 176。 C , 176。 C 和 176。 C的 增量。 其中傳感器默認為 12位。該 DS18B20在低功耗空閑狀態(tài) ;啟動 溫度測量和 模數(shù) 轉換,主機必須發(fā)出一個 轉換命令 。轉換后,所產生的數(shù)據(jù)存儲在內存中的 2比特溫度 寄存器中, DS18B20返回其空閑狀態(tài)。如果 DS18B20是由外部電源供電 的 ,主機可以發(fā)出 “ 讀時隙 ” ,轉換后 ,通過發(fā)送低電平 T命令和 DS18B20將響應, 同時 溫度轉換 繼續(xù) 進 行 , 當轉換完成 時變?yōu)楦唠娖?。如果 DS18B20的是寄生電源供電 的 ,在整個溫度轉換 過程中 此通知技術不能使用,因為 總線 必須 變?yōu)楦唠娖?。總線需要 寄生電源 供電將在 此資料 的 DS18B20驅動部分 將詳細介紹。 DS18B20 的輸出溫度數(shù)據(jù) 為標準 攝氏度 。對于 華氏 溫度的 應用, 必須通過 查表或 運用轉換 方法 。溫度數(shù)據(jù)在溫度寄存器存儲為一個 16位符號擴展 位和 2位的補碼 。該標志位( S)表示溫度 的 正負符號位 : 為正數(shù)時 S = 0,為 負數(shù) 時 S = 1。如果是 DS18B20配置 為 12位分辨率,在溫度寄存器的所有位將包含有效數(shù)據(jù)。對于 11 位分辨率,位 0是 未 定 義 的。對于10位分辨率,位 1和 0是 未 定 義 的 。對于 9位分辨率 , 位 2, 1和 0是未定義的。表 2給出了輸出數(shù)字數(shù)據(jù) 和 相應 的 12位分辨率溫度讀數(shù)轉換例子 。 五. 運用 報警信號 DS18B20 溫度轉換 完成后 ,溫度值與用戶定義的 2 個 報警觸發(fā)值存儲在 1 個字節(jié)的 TH和 TL寄存器。符號位( S) 表示溫度值的正負 : S = 0時為正值, S = 1為 負 值 。 TH和 TL寄存器是非易失( EEPROM),因此他們將保留設備掉電 時的 數(shù)據(jù)。 TH 和 TL 可通過 暫存器中 字節(jié) 2和 3獲得,此內容 在本數(shù)據(jù)表內存部分解釋 。 六. TH 和 TL寄存器格式 只有溫度寄存器 4中的 11 位 用于 和 TL 的比較中,由于 TH和 TL都是 8位寄存器。如果測量溫度低于或等于 TL或超過 TH,報警情況存在 而且報警標志將設置在 DS18B20的內部。每 個 溫度測量 后, 這個標志 位將被更新 ,因此,如果報警條件消失,下一個溫度轉換 后, 該標志 位 將被關閉。主設備可以 通過搜索 ECH命令 檢查總線上所有 DS18B20s 報警標志 位 的狀態(tài)。任何 有 設置報警標志 位的 DS18B20s 將響應命令,所以 主設備 可以決定到底是哪 個DS18B20s在 經歷一個報警條件。如果報警的情況存在 , TH和 TL設置已 經改變了,另一個溫度轉換應該 去 驗證報警條件 。 七. DS18B20 的驅動 該傳感器 DS18B20可以用外部電源接 VDD端供電 ,或者它可以 工作 在 “ 寄生 電源 ” 模式下 , 這種模式 允許 DS18B20在沒有外部電源下工作 。寄生 電源在遠程或者 空間受限 情況下感溫 是非常有用的。寄生功率控制電路,其中 當 總線引腳 為 高 電平時, 力部門宿舍從 DS18B201通過 連接單 總線 的 DQ 端 “ 偷 ” 電。 當 總線 是高電平或者總線是低電平,而一些能量存貯在CPP中來提供電源,“偷”來的電位 DS18B20提供驅動。 當 DS18B20在寄生電源模式下使用時, VDD引腳必須接地。在寄生電源模式下, 單 總線和 CPP可以提供足夠的電流給 DS18B20的大部分操作,只要指定的時間和電壓的要求得到滿足(參考本數(shù)據(jù)手冊 DC電氣特性和 AC 電氣特性章節(jié)) 。 然而,當 DS18B20 溫度轉換或復制暫存器 的 數(shù)據(jù)到 EEPROM時 ,工作電流可高達 毫安 。這個電流會導致 無法 接受 的電壓下降, 整個 單總線 電阻壓降 減小, 更多的電流可以由寄生電源供應 。為了確保 DS18B20有足夠的電流 供應 , 無論正在發(fā)生 溫度轉換 或 復制暫存器的 數(shù)據(jù)到 EEPROM,單 總線 都 必須 接 一個 強上拉電阻。 這可以通過使用一個 MOSFET以直接 把總線電壓下降到 如圖 4所示。 單 總線必須 在 轉換 T[44h]或暫存器復制 [48H]命令發(fā)出后, 10秒內(最大) 轉換到 強上拉 狀態(tài) , 而且總線 必須 在 轉換( tconv)或數(shù)據(jù)傳輸( twr = 10ms) 期間通過上拉保持高 電平。 在 單 總線上拉 使能時, 其他活動 不能發(fā)生 。該 DS18B20的也可以采用的連接外部電源到 VDD腳上的傳統(tǒng)方法 。 這種方法的優(yōu)點是不需要 MOSFET的上拉, 而且單 總線可以 在 進行溫度轉換時間自由地進行其他操作 。 在 +100℃ 以上的高溫 時 不推薦 使用寄生電源 ,因為在這些溫度下存在 較高 泄漏電流 , DS18B20可能無法維持通信。對于 像 在這 種高溫下的使用 ,強烈建議由一個 DS18B20的外部電源供電。在某些情況下,總線主機可能不知道 DS18B20s 是外部 電源還是 寄生 電源供 電 。主 機 需要這些信息來確定是否強大的總線上拉應在溫度轉換 時 使用。要獲得這些信息,主機可以 在 “ 閱讀時段 ” 一個讀取電源 [B4h]命令后 ,發(fā)出一個跳過 ROM[CCh]命令。在讀時隙,寄生 電源給 DS18B20s供電將把 總線 電平拉 低,外部供電 時 DS18B20s將會讓總線 仍然保持 高 電平 。如果總線拉低,主 機 知道在溫度轉換 期間 它必須提供 單 總線強上 拉 。 八. 64位激光 ROM 每一 DS1820 包括一個唯一的 64 位長的 ROM 編碼。開紿的 8 位是單線產品系列編碼: 28h,接著的 48 位是唯一的系列號。最重要的 8 位是開始 56 位 CRC 位,從 56位的ROM端計算而來。 CRC比特的詳細內容將在 CRC概述一章中介紹。 64位 ROM代碼和相關 ROM功能控制邏輯使 DS18B20作為使用協(xié)議的單 線 設備 的運作, 單 總線系統(tǒng)的數(shù)據(jù)表部分詳細介紹了這個協(xié)議 。 九. 存貯器 DS1820 的存貯器那樣被組織 存貯器由一個高速暫存 便箋式 RAM、一個存貯高溫度和低溫 度和觸發(fā)器 TH 和 TL的非易失性電可擦除 E2RAM和 存儲配置寄存器 組成。 請注意,如果 DS18B20的報警功能 不 使用, TH和 TL寄存器可以作為通用存儲器。 DS18B20的功能命令部分詳細敘述了所有內存的命令。暫存器 的 字節(jié) 0和字節(jié) 1分別包含 LSB和 MSB溫度寄存器。這些字節(jié)是只讀的。字節(jié) 2和 3提供 是提供 接入的 TH和 TL寄存器。字節(jié) 4包含配置寄存器數(shù)據(jù),數(shù)據(jù)表配置寄存器部分詳細解釋 了它的內容 。字節(jié) 5, 6和 7是保留供內部使用的設備,不能被覆蓋, 當被讀到時, 這些字節(jié)將返回 1秒 。 8字節(jié)暫存器是只讀的,并且包含了循環(huán)冗余校驗 碼, 通過暫存器 的 0到 7字節(jié)。 DS18B20使用在 CRC生成一節(jié)中描述的方法生成該 CRC。數(shù)據(jù)寫入字節(jié) 2, 3,暫存器 4使用寫入暫存 [4Eh]指令 。數(shù)據(jù)必須傳輸?shù)?DS18B20以 最低有效位開始的 第 2字節(jié)。為了驗證數(shù)據(jù)的完整性, 數(shù)據(jù)被寫入后 暫存器可以讀取(使用數(shù)據(jù)讀取暫存器 [與 Beh]命令)。當讀取暫存器,數(shù)據(jù) 是從 最低有效位 的 0字節(jié) 開始的。要傳送的 TH, TL和配置數(shù)據(jù)從暫存器到 EEPROM,主機必須 發(fā)起復制 暫存 [48h]命令。設備 關機 時, 在 EEPROM寄存器的數(shù)據(jù) 將 被保留,上電時 EEPROM中的數(shù)據(jù) 到相應的位置暫存器重新加載。數(shù)據(jù)也可以使用召回 E2 [B8h]命令在任何時間從 EEPROM中重新加載向暫存器。主機 可以 在 召回 E2 命令后 發(fā)出讀時隙后 , DS18B20的將通過傳輸 0 表明 處在召回狀態(tài) , 當召回完成時將傳輸 1。 十. 配置寄存器 暫存存儲器 的第四 字節(jié)包含配置寄存器。用戶可以使用該寄存器的 R0 和 R1 的位設置DS18B20的轉換分辨率。這些位默認是 R0和 R1都等于 1( 12位)的分辨率。請注意,兩者之間是有直接的分辨率和轉換時間的 對比 。第 7位,并在配置寄存器 0至 4位是保留供內部使用的設備,不能被覆蓋,這些位 被 讀出時 將 返回 1秒 。 十一 .CRC生成 CRC字節(jié)是 DS18B20的 64位 ROM代碼的一部分,在暫存器 的第 9比特 。 CRC的代碼 是由前 56位的 ROM代碼計算出 的 ,并 處在 ROM中最重要的字節(jié)。暫存器中 的 CRC代碼是由 儲存器中 的數(shù)據(jù)計算 出來的 ,因此它變化時,在暫存器 中的數(shù)據(jù)也會 變化。 CRCs 提供 總線主機數(shù)據(jù)驗證方法, 當 主機從 DS18B20讀取數(shù)據(jù) 時 。為了驗證數(shù)據(jù)已被正確讀取,總線主機必須從接收到的數(shù)據(jù) 中 重新計算 CRC,然后比較此值無論是 ROM代碼( 為 ROM讀)或暫存器的 CRC(為暫存器讀?。?。 如果計算 出的 CRC與讀 到的 CRC匹配, 說明 已收到的數(shù)據(jù)準確無誤。 CRC的值比較, 是否 繼續(xù) 運作 完全由總線主機 決定 。如果 DS18B20的 CR( ROM或暫存器) 與 由總線主機產生的 值 不匹配 , DS18B20中沒有任何電路阻止 命令序列的 進程。 由總線主機產生的價值電路。 CRC的 同等多項式函數(shù)( ROM或暫存器)是 : CRC = X8+ X5 + X4+ 1 總 線主機可以重新計算 CRC,然后使用 多項式發(fā)生器 與 從 DS18B20得 到用的 CRC值 進行比較。該電路由一個移位寄存器和 XOR門組成 ,移位寄存器初 始化為 0。 從 暫存器最低有效位或 0字節(jié)的最低有效位的開始,每次一 比特 應該移入移位寄存器。從 ROM或從暫存器中最重要的 第 7字節(jié)轉移 到第 56比特后 ,多項式發(fā)生器將包含重新計算 的 CRC校驗碼。接下來,8位 ROM代碼或暫存器從 DS18B20的 CRC必須轉移到電路。此時,如果重新計算 的 CRC是正確的,移位寄存器將包含所有 0。對達拉斯的 單總線 循環(huán)冗余校驗的更多信息在應用筆記 27:理解和使用觸摸與達拉斯半導體存儲器產品的循環(huán)冗余校驗 中有詳細介紹。
點擊復制文檔內容
研究報告相關推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1